Retail - Baku, , Azerbaijan
•The Project "ADA" had started in September, 2005, with the aim of establishing a modern retail commodity chain in Baku.•In short time, the team of experts with experience of project management and retail sales was established. •In January, 2006 the strategic business-plan of development considering opening 50 modern markets under "ALMALI" brand in Baku city, and construction of a modern Distribution Center in Khirdalan settlement by 2009, was adopted. •According to business-plan in 2009, quantity of newly created jobs only in "ALMALI" chain not including related sectors will exceed 2000. Currently company's personnel consist of more than 1500 employees.•In regard to the size of investments made in the non-oil sector and positive impact on the economy of Azerbaijan, the project "ADA" sets an example of the importance of the non-oil sector.• More than 50,000,000 USD from various sources have been invested towards the success and growth of the company.•In November 2006, the Board of Directors of the International Financial Corporation (IFC) made a decision to finance the project with 18 million US dollars for the development of the chain, including a 6,000,000 USD equity investment.• In 2008, the Black Sea Trade and Development bank made a decision to lend the amount of $ 9,5 million for the further expansion of the company.•The first market of the chain was opened on 90, Babek Avenue, on October 28th, 2006. At present, 40 chain markets are being operated. Along with Azerbaijan's capital Baku, "Almali" supermarket chain is also operating in major cities of Azerbaijan such as Ganja and Sumgayit.
